Tomb 66 is a Bronze Age (Wadi Suq Period), clover shaped , subterranean stone-lined tomb with interconnected burial chambers. Investigations of this tomb resulted in the discovery of many burials and associated funerary offerings including bronze spearheads, a dagger blade and bowl, and several soft stone vessels.Citation: Jasim, Sabah Abboud (2012) The Necropolis of Jebel al-Buhais: Prehistoric Discoveries in the Emirate of Sharjah, UAE, pp174-186. Department of Culture and Information, Government of Sharjah, UAE.
